Transaction 7541638cbf21cd3917b7c940f12b423975ba3cee8a2a2494e4dcad654a8370ac
1 Input
1 Output
-
7541638cbf21cd3917b7c940f12b423975ba3cee8a2a2494e4dcad654a8370ac:0
- value
- 5429288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91f2853b614f1b16049ff011b10a5f2f852cc3a2 OP_EQUAL
- address
- 3EziRyUg9ChCbE1QzLLMJUuTc6xJVr39fJ